New graduates entering the construction management field in Hannibal, Missouri, can expect an entry-level salary starting around $68,379 in 2026. This figure represents the lower end of the salary spectrum, significantly below the median salary of $103,618 for all construction managers in the area. In the early years, it's realistic for newcomers to transition from this entry point to the 25th percentile, which is projected at $82,643. Considering the growth trajectory of 3.42% annually, Hannibal proves to be a viable market for aspiring construction managers, providing a pathway that can lead to increased earning potential over time as they gain experience in this competitive field.

Salary Trajectory for Construction Managers in Hannibal (2019–2027)
2019–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 3.42% projection.
| Year | Annual Salary |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| $53,263 | Actual |
| 2020 | $53,965 | Actual |
| 2021 | $56,972 | Actual |
| 2022 | $59,021 | Actual |
| 2023 | $61,175 | Actual |
| 2024 | $54,828 | Actual |
| 2025 | $66,118 |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$68,379 | Estimated |
| 2027 | $70,718 | Projected |
Entry-level construction manager compensation (10th percentile) in Hannibal, MO grew 24.1% over 7 years based on actual BLS metropolitan area surveys, rising from $53,263 in 2019 to $66,118 in 2025. By 2027, starting salaries are projected to reach $70,718. New graduates entering the Hannibal job market can expect continued year-over-year gains.
